Livingston WFC 5-0 Falkirk WFC
An emphatic performance from the Lionesses as they put 5 past Falkirk at the Home of The Set Fare Arena. With strikes from Cairney, Whiteford, Moran and Daly the difference between the sides. Livingston had the lions share of the chances with the Falkirk goalkeeper making vital saves to deny more goals, most notably from the spot early into the 2nd half.
The first half started slowly with the sides trading blows throughout the course of the 45. Livingston struck first; unfortunately, a slightly early run led to the official raising the flag, keeping the sides even. A few more chances fell the way of the Lionesses, with a combination of goalkeeping and near misses ensuring the tie was level going into the break.
The second 45 started swiftly with a penalty going the way of Livingston within the first few minutes. However, the Falkirk goalkeeper got down low to her left to make the save. This started a flurry of Livingston possession and chances; it was only a matter of time before the first went in from Cairney, who picked the ball up just outside the box, skipped past a defender and fired into the near post top corner to give a well-deserved lead to the home side.
The floodgates really opened after that, with Whitehead finding home just a few minutes later, picking up the scraps after a save from the goalkeeper and making sure the chance didn’t go awry. A double change shortly after for the Lions with Strain and McCulloch replacing Whiteford and D.Brown.
Livingston really turned up the heat, adding a third to the tally through Moran, who is found by a cross-box pass from Daly and is able to calmly slot it past the diving goalkeeper. The net wasn’t empty for long, as fresh off her assist Daly adds a goal of her own to the scoresheet as her effort from the wide right area finds the far side of the Falkirk net.
3 more changes in the final 10 for Livingston, Whitson, Mason and Murray replacing Canavan, Rogers and an injured Strain.
Adding the icing on the second-half goal cake, Cairney grabs her second of the afternoon, finding the back of the net from outside the box again, lethal from range today.
An inspired second-half performance saw Livingston walk out 5 goals to the good in today’s Sky Sports Cup duel.
